As of now, New Zealand reports a miscellaneous goods and services consumer price index of 130.6, signifying an increase of 7.8 (6.4%) from 2023.

New Zealand Miscellaneous goods and services index between 2007 and 2024
| Period |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 130.6 | +7.8 |
| 2023 | 122.8 | +5.3 |
| 2022 | 117.5 | +5.5 |
| 2021 | 111.9 | +3.4 |
| 2020 | 108.6 | +2.5 |
| 2019 | 106.1 | +2.6 |
| 2018 | 103.5 | +2.7 |
| 2017 | 100.7 | +2.1 |
| 2016 | 98.6 | +1.4 |
| 2015 | 97.2 | +1.2 |
| 2014 | 96.0 | +1.6 |
| 2013 | 94.3 | +2.2 |
| 2012 | 92.2 | +3.0 |
| 2011 | 89.1 | +2.8 |
| 2010 | 86.4 | +1.0 |
| 2009 | 85.4 | +2.5 |
| 2008 | 82.9 | +2.0 |
| 2007 | 80.9 |
